Rodger Page
About Rodger Page
Rodger Page is a Creative & New Media Design Manager at Codeless Platforms, where he has worked since 2008. He holds a BA (Hons) in Software Systems for the Arts & Media from the University of Hertfordshire and has extensive experience in web design, UI/UX design, and project management.

Education and Expertise
Rodger Page studied at the University of Hertfordshire, where he earned a BA (Hons) in Software Systems for the Arts & Media, achieving a 2:1 classification from 1999 to 2002. He also holds a B-Tech National Diploma in Information Technology Applications from The People’s College - Nottingham, completed between 1994 and 1996. His expertise includes designing responsive websites, UI and UX design, and utilizing Google Material Design concepts.
Professional Background
Rodger Page has a diverse professional background in digital media and web development. Prior to his current role, he worked as a Freelance Writer at Imagine Publishing from 2005 to 2007. He also served as a Tutor in Web Design at Bournemouth and Poole College from 2007 to 2009 and as a Web Developer at Bournemouth University from 2007 to 2008. His early career included roles such as Multimedia Editor/Web Coordinator at Imagine Publishing and Digital Imaging Technician at Nottingham Evening Post.
